The İzozoel Church, located in Altıntaş (Keferze) village of Midyat, was built, according to a belief, in the early 6th century by the architects Theodosius and Theodore, sons of Shufnayn, the architect of the Mor Gabriel Monastery. However, according another tradition this church was built in the 8th century, when Tur Abdin was in its heyday.
